This is just some notes I made, mostly taken from http://docs.phonegap.com/en/3.0.0/guide_overview_index.md.html.I was installing PhoneGap 3.0.0 on Ubuntu 12.04.I use Sublime Text 3 for development, so didn’t want any of the Eclipse-based
tools.EnvironmentFirst, upgrade npm, and get the latest nodejs (by installing ‘n’ and running
that):npm update npm -g
sudo npm install n -g
sudo n stable
No...
phonegap的安装路途曲折,首先要基于多种程序,中途还要解决各种问题,下面是phonegap需要的程序1、NodeJs2、Phonegap3、jdk,jre4、Apache Ant5、AndroidSDK步骤:1.安装nodejs。 2.成功后在cmd中npm install -g phonegap,自动下载安装phonegap。 3.下载jdk并安装jdk,jre(不要装在\Program Files文件加下,jdk的安装目录下不能有空格),并配置环境变量。 4.下载Apache ANT解压到任意目录,并配置环境变量。 5.下载AndroidSDK并...
程序总要更新的,apple 等appstore 处理,android版 自动更新,上代码/*** 检查并更新APP */(function (cordova) {var define = cordova.define;define("cordova/plugin/updateApp", function (require, exports, module) {var argscheck = require('cordova/argscheck'),exec = require('cordova/exec');exports.checkAndUpdate = function (content, successCB, failCB) {exec(successCB, failCB, "UpdateApp", "checkAndUpdate"...
最近项目进度不是很紧张,经理就跟我们提了一下看是否能在项目中使用phonegap,他想通过引入phonegap来解决屏幕适配和减少android,ios开发难度的问题.于是,花了一周来大致了解了一下phonegap,但现在还没确定它的使用场景.一.phonegap的引入我使用的是比较老的phonegap-2.9.0(因为这个网上资料比较多,而且它的demo内容比较丰富,当前最新的demo感觉比较差,看完连他能实现什么都不知道,所以我就放弃了使用最新的,但最新的应该会更新一些...
嗨,大家好,我是javascript和html的新手.能否请您向我建议如何在phonegap android中实现轻扫?感谢您的宝贵建议.解决方法:如果您使用的是jQuery mobile,则可以使用内置的事件滑动.
Documentation
例如.:$("#myContainer").on("swipe", function(event) {alert("I got swiped!");
});如果您使用的是jQuery UI,请查看jQuery UI Touch Punch.jQuery UI Touch Punch is a small hack that enables the use of touch events on sites us...
关于PhoneGap插件的编码,PhoneGap Wiki说:Say you are developing a PhoneGap Plugin for 2 platforms: iOS and Android.One might assume that we need to churn out:
A single JavaScript file that will be used on both iOS and AndroidOne Java file for AndroidOne .h and One .m for iOS
However, in reality you will need to churn out:
One JavaScript file for Android, along with a Java file for AndroidA differen...
我有一个sencha touch2应用程序示例.在我的本地浏览器(http://localhost/sencha/examples/navigationview/index.html)中,它工作正常.
现在我需要使用phonegap 1.5.0将这个sencha应用程序集成到android中.我已经从phonegap下载了phonegap库
phonegap网站上的phonegap-phonegap-1.5.0-0-gde1960d.zip.在那我有cordova-1.5.0.js和cordova-1.5.0.jar文件而不是phonegap.我已经遍历了phonegap网站,知道cordova-1.5.0和phonegap是相同的...
我已经使用带有插件的Android应用程序创建了PhoneGap 1.4 /.
我的客户报告说,当他使用“主页”按钮离开应用程序,然后使用应用程序图标重新启动它时,该应用程序从头开始重新启动,而不是重新启动.但是,当他按锁或进入睡眠状态时,应用程序将以预期的方式恢复.
应用的初始化过程是这样声明的:public void onCreate(Bundle savedInstanceState) {super.onCreate(savedInstanceState);Log.d("EMOFIDActivity", "onCreatee " + this.getI...
我一直在寻找答案,但似乎我发现的大部分是旧版的PhoneGap.
这是我的链接代码:<a href="#" onclick="window.open('http://acq.com/account/', '_system', 'location=yes');">My Account</a>此代码绝对不执行任何操作.我单击链接,但没有任何反应.
是的,我在HTML页面上添加了phonegap.js.
任何人都知道我还需要做什么才能使它正常工作.这是我要执行的PhoneGap应用程序中的唯一链接. :/解决方法:听起来很奇怪,您需要在项目中安装InAp...
我正在为android构建应用程序.但是后来我看到了:[ReferenceError: a is not defined]
exec: ant clean -f "/Users/chaitanya/BPEase/platforms/android/build.xml"
[ 'ant clean -f "/Users/chaitanya/BPEase/platforms/android/build.xml"',{ [Error: Command failed: BUILD FAILED/Users/chaitanya/BPEase/platforms/android/build.xml:90: Cannot find /Applications/eclipse/sdk/tools/ant/build.xml imported from /Users/ch...
我正在开发带phonegap的应用程序.我想在运动场中使用flexbox,但是我遇到了以下问题:
Chrome,Mozilla,Android 4.4-http://i.stack.imgur.com/1aunA.jpg
安卓-2.x-4.3.x-http://i.stack.imgur.com/yqIf0.jpgplayfield {width: 408px;height: 408px;margin: 0px;padding: 0px;margin-left: auto;margin-right: auto;display: -webkit-box;display: -moz-box;display: -o-box;display: -ms-flexbox;display: -webkit-flex;display: fl...
在过去的一周中,我一直在与之作斗争,但进展甚微甚至没有进展.最初,当我第一次使用phonegap制作我的应用程序时,它将显示黑屏,而没有其他显示.从那以后,我添加了一个启动屏幕并更改了config.xml中的背景颜色,从那时起,它就显示了启动屏幕,然后显示了白色屏幕,而不是黑色屏幕.
该应用程序可以很好地用作网站,所以我真的不知道从哪里开始调试. phonegap构建调试器没有任何内容,因为它根本不显示应用程序的任何元素.
当出现问题时,phone...
我目前正在做一个应用程序,通过手机中的加速度计来检测道路上的坑洼.我的问题是我需要重新调整加速度计轴的方向以使其与汽车轴对齐.
我在下面的在线报告中找到了这种解释,但我不知道如何使用GPS计算旋转后的角度以及如何监视旋转前的角度.
在线说明:
“手机可以任意摆放,因此,嵌入式加速度计.因此,必须先沿车辆轴线定向分析信号.该系统使用基于欧拉角的算法重新定位.通过预旋转,传感器实际上沿着车辆的轴线旋转,倾斜角和旋转后角(...
我试图了解一切工作原理,但是对此主题有一些疑问.
我将解释我如何理解这些内容.
首先让我们从Cordova开始,这是一个将JS,CSS,HTML文件转换为本地应用程序的平台.但是,这并不是完全正确的.实际上,它只是将所有html,css文件放入资产文件夹,而该平台所做的只是创建针对该平台的自定义WebView,对其进行配置,将所有必需的插件绑定到该WebView并将默认页面设置为打开.除平台插件提供的钩子方法外,其他所有内容都只是Web开发,该方法可通过W...
我已经使用PhoneGap在Eclipse Indigo中创建了一个Demo Android Application.现在,我想将相同的应用程序部署到iPhone平台.可能吗?还是我也必须从头开始为iPhone呢?
任何建议或窍门表示赞赏.